As the Clean Energy Transition progresses, one of many questions that’s typically requested is “How a lot land is required for photo voltaic power improvement?”

An bold build-out of utility-scale photo voltaic in Michigan would require about 2.5 % of our 10 million acres of agricultural land. In comparability, at this time we commit between 7 and 10 % of the land to corn ethanol manufacturing, which is a really damaging and inefficient use of that land.

A latest research by Renew Wisconsin confirmed that, evaluating farm use for ethanol or photo voltaic, measured by the potential for EV vs combustion automobile mileage, confirmed that …the ethanol utilized in inside combustion engines requires about 85 instances the quantity of land to energy the identical quantity of driving as solar-charged electrical automobiles.”

A big physique of analysis has emerged exhibiting the constructive results of photo voltaic initiatives on enhancing soil well being, supporting pollinators and helpful bugs, and increasing biodiversity. One such research just lately got here from the Argonne National Lab, which adopted two photo voltaic fields positioned on a farm for 4 years, and located, amongst different advantages, …rising the abundance and variety of native insect pollinators and agriculturally helpful bugs, together with bees, native bees, wasps, hornets, hoverflies, different flies, moths, butterflies and beetles. Flowers and flowering plant species additionally elevated. The whole insect inhabitants tripled, whereas the honey bees confirmed a 20-fold enhance.”

Research from Europe reveals that photo voltaic fields present habitat for birds and small mammals, help larger richness and variety, and assist rebuild the underside of the meals chain, which has been damaged of many years of commercial farming and unstoppable improvement.

Recent work by the Yale Center for Business and the Environment reveals comparable advantages, but in addition flags the position of photo voltaic in recharging native groundwater programs.

Native vegetation and pollinators typically planted round photo voltaic fields develop deep roots, and draw vitamins into the soil, sequester carbon and replenish native aquifers.
